(2R)-2-Ammonio-3,3-dimethylbutanoate is a chiral compound with the chemical formula C6H13NO2. It is characterized by an ammonium group attached to the second carbon of a butanoate chain, which features two methyl branches on the third carbon. This compound is commonly used in synthetic chemistry as a building block for pharmaceutical and organic synthesis applications.
(2R)-2-Ammonio-3,3-dimethylbutanoate finds applications in pharmaceuticals as a chiral intermediate for drug development, in industrial chemistry for polymer synthesis, and in research for enantiomer separation. It is also used in organic synthesis to create complex molecules with specific stereochemical configurations.
The safety of (2R)-2-Ammonio-3,3-dimethylbutanoate depends on exposure conditions. It is generally considered low toxicity but should be handled with appropriate PPE to avoid skin or eye contact. Safety data sheets (SDS) recommend working in well-ventilated areas and following standard chemical handling protocols to ensure compliance with safety regulations.
(2R)-2-Ammonio-3,3-dimethylbutanoate should be stored in a cool, dry place away from light. It is recommended to keep it in airtight containers made of inert materials like glass or polyethylene to maintain stability. Avoid exposure to moisture and ensure proper labeling for safe preservation.
